Rubber prices on 02 Sept
ERJ staff report (DS)
London -- On Tokyo's Tocom Exchange, prices for the six-month contract eased overnight, trading at around yen 370 ($4.81) per kg on Friday 2 Sept. Shorter-dated prices were trading around at yen 360.
In Singapore, SGX said prices for RSS3 for delivery in February 2012 were down slightly, at $4.79, while short-dated contracts were trading around $4.73. TSR20 for delivery in January 2012 was trading around $4.64.5.
In India, the NMCE said prices were up on te early part of this week with September deliveries priced at Rs 219 ($4.76).
In China, the Shanghai Futures Exchange also saw prices rise by a faction of a yuan, with September deliveries trading at around Yuan 33.3 ($5.21) per kilo
